Output 8663864a1b98e2f9cb92b5e884594c4da508e55ed977133875fea1b40dcf9b04:3

value
100984000
script pubkey
OP_0 OP_PUSHBYTES_20 28780585f42a6a5809454b4397191c8513730c29
address
bc1q9puqtp059f49sz29fdpewxgus5fhxrpfsln6dp
transaction
8663864a1b98e2f9cb92b5e884594c4da508e55ed977133875fea1b40dcf9b04
spent
true